2025 獨立開發者軍火庫:揭秘 Indie Hacker 的「Vibe Stack」,一個人也能完成產品開發到上線

2026/01/13 | AI 人工智慧新知, N8N大補帖, WP 開發技巧, 全端與程式開發

獨立開發者的 AI 革命:Vibe Stack 軍火庫

2025 年的開發典範已從「全端」轉向令人興奮的「Vibe Stack」!這套終極軍火庫的核心精神是:讓 AI 處理 80% 的髒活,獨立開發者(Indie Hacker)只專注於 20% 的靈感與決策。本文深度拆解這套高效流程,包含 AI 結對程式設計師 Cursor、被低估的 WordPress 後端骨架、流程自動化神器 n8n,以及生成式 UI 工具 v0.dev。掌握 Vibe Stack,意味著速度優先於完美,您一個人就能擁有整支團隊的開發火力。停止無謂的重複勞動,立即升級您的開發策略,將創意快速變現!立即聯繫浪花科技,導入這套頂尖的 AI 自動化流程,實現您產品快速上線的夢想!

需要專業協助?

聯絡浪花專案團隊 →

2025 獨立開發者軍火庫:揭秘 Indie Hacker 的「Vibe Stack」,一個人也能完成產品開發到上線

嗨,我是 Eric,浪花科技的資深工程師。最近在開發者圈子裡(特別是 X/Twitter 和 Reddit 的 Indie Hacker 社群),有一個詞紅得發紫,那就是「Vibe Coding」。

這不僅僅是一個 Buzzword,它代表了 2025 年軟體開發的一場典範轉移。以前我們談論「全端工程師 (Full Stack)」,你需要精通前端 React、後端 Node.js/PHP、資料庫 SQL 還有 DevOps。但現在?我們談論的是「Vibe Stack」。

什麼是 Indie Hacker 的 Vibe Stack?簡單來說,就是「讓 AI 處理 80% 的髒活,人類只負責 20% 的靈感與決策」的終極工具組合。這篇文章,我要以一個資深 WordPress 開發者的角度,帶你拆解這套讓一個人也能幹掉一個團隊的開發軍火庫。

什麼是 Vibe Stack?為什麼 Indie Hacker 都在用?

Andrej Karpathy(前 Tesla AI 總監)曾半開玩笑地說:「我現在寫程式大都在 Vibe Coding。」意思是,他不再逐行敲打語法,而是將需求「詠唱」給 AI,然後審查結果,感覺對了(Vibe check passed),程式碼就過了。

對於獨立開發者(Indie Hacker)來說,時間就是金錢。我們沒有預算請 UI 設計師、後端工程師和運維人員。Vibe Stack 的核心精神是:速度 > 完美,功能 > 架構。

一套標準的 2025 Vibe Stack 通常包含以下四個面向:

  • 大腦 (The Brain): AI 驅動的 IDE (Cursor / Windsurf)。
  • 骨架 (The Backbone): 快速成型的後端與資料庫 (WordPress / Supabase)。
  • 神經系統 (The Nervous System): 自動化串接 (n8n)。
  • 門面 (The Face): 生成式 UI (v0.dev / Tailwind)。

1. 大腦:從 VS Code 到 Cursor 的進化

身為工程師,我必須承認,轉移到 Cursor 是我今年做過最正確的決定之一。雖然 VS Code 加上 GitHub Copilot 很強,但 Cursor 是「原生」為 AI 打造的。

在 Vibe Stack 中,IDE 不再只是編輯器,它是你的「結對程式設計師」。你可以直接把整個 WordPress 外掛的官方文件丟給 Cursor,然後說:「幫我寫一個 Custom Post Type,並自動產生 REST API 端點。」

Eric 的小囉嗦:
以前我們要去查 WordPress Code Reference,看 `register_post_type` 到底有哪些參數。現在?我只負責 Review AI 寫出來的 Code 有沒有安全性漏洞。這讓原本需要兩小時的工作,縮短到 15 分鐘。

2. 骨架:為什麼 WordPress 仍是 Indie Hacker 的神級後端?

在 Vibe Stack 的討論中,很多人會推崇 Next.js + Supabase。這當然很棒,但對於要快速驗證商業模式的 Indie Hacker 來說,WordPress 其實是被低估的超級武器。

為什麼?因為 WordPress 自帶了「會員系統」、「後台管理介面 (Admin Panel)」、「內容管理」和「權限控管」。你不需要重新發明輪子。

我們可以把 WordPress 當作 Headless CMSApp Framework 來用。配合 AI,我們可以快速寫出強大的 API。

實戰:用 AI 快速生成會員專屬 API

想像一下,你正在做一個 SaaS 產品,需要一個 API 讓外部的前端 (可能是 React 或 Vue) 獲取使用者的訂閱狀態。在 Vibe Coding 的模式下,你只需要告訴 AI 你的需求,它就能產出如下的標準程式碼:


add_action( 'rest_api_init', function () {
    register_rest_route( 'vibe-stack/v1', '/subscription-status', array(
        'methods' => 'GET',
        'callback' => 'roamer_check_subscription',
        'permission_callback' => function () {
            return is_user_logged_in();
        }
    ) );
} );

function roamer_check_subscription( $data ) {
    $user_id = get_current_user_id();
    // 假設我們用 user_meta 儲存訂閱狀態
    $status = get_user_meta( $user_id, 'subscription_status', true );
    
    if ( empty( $status ) ) {
        $status = 'free';
    }

    return new WP_REST_Response( array(
        'user_id' => $user_id,
        'status'  => $status,
        'message' => 'Data retrieved successfully via Vibe Stack API'
    ), 200 );
}

這段程式碼雖然簡單,但它包含了權限驗證 (`permission_callback`) 和標準的 REST Response。在 Vibe Stack 中,我們不手寫這些,我們只負責定義邏輯。

3. 神經系統:n8n 自動化流程

一個成功的產品,不只是程式碼,還有營運。當用戶註冊後,誰寄歡迎信?當訂單成立後,誰通知 Slack?這時候 n8n 就登場了。

在 Vibe Stack 中,我們盡量減少在核心程式碼中寫死「寄信」或「第三方串接」的邏輯,而是透過 Webhook 把資料拋給 n8n。

  • 解耦: 你的 WordPress 不會因為寄信服務掛掉而變慢。
  • 可視化: 你可以在 n8n 拉線條,決定「如果是 VIP 客戶,就傳 LINE 通知老闆」。
  • AI 整合: n8n 可以輕易串接 OpenAI 或 Anthropic,讓你的後台自動化具備「理解能力」。

4. 門面:v0.dev 與 Tailwind CSS

這是我覺得最震撼的部分。對於後端出身的 Indie Hacker (像我),刻 CSS 簡直是地獄。但現在有了 v0.dev (Vercel 推出的生成式 UI 工具),你只要輸入:「幫我設計一個像 Linear 風格的 Dashboard,要有深色模式和圓角卡片。」

它會直接吐給你 React + Tailwind CSS 的程式碼。你把這些程式碼貼到你的 WordPress 自訂區塊 (Gutenberg Block) 或前端專案中,瞬間就有了一個專業級的介面。

Eric 的技術筆記: 雖然 AI 能生成漂亮的 UI,但建議你還是要懂 Tailwind CSS 的基礎 class,這樣在微調間距 (padding/margin) 時才不會手忙腳亂。

如何整合這套 Vibe Stack?

這是一套我推薦給 2025 年想獨自開發產品的 Indie Hacker 的標準流程:

  1. 構思與設計: 使用 v0.dev 生成介面原型,確認 UI 邏輯。
  2. 核心開發: 打開 Cursor,載入 WordPress 專案。透過 Composer 安裝必要的套件。
  3. 後端邏輯: 用自然語言指揮 Cursor 撰寫 Custom Post Types 和 REST API (如上面的範例)。
  4. 自動化串接: 在 WordPress 設定 Webhook,當資料變動時,觸發 n8n 流程 (例如:將新用戶資料寫入 Google Sheets 或 CRM)。
  5. 部署: 使用 GitHub Actions 進行 CI/CD,自動部署到 Cloudways 或類似的 VPS 環境。

結論:別讓技術細節扼殺了你的產品

Vibe Stack 的出現,並不是要讓工程師失業,而是讓我們「升級」。我們不再是單純的 Code Monkey,我們是產品的架構師與指揮官。

作為 Indie Hacker,你的目標是解決使用者的問題,而不是寫出最優雅的演算法。善用 Cursor、WordPress、n8n 這些工具,你一個人就能擁有一支軍隊的火力。這就是 2025 年開發產品最迷人的地方。

推薦閱讀

如果你想深入了解如何構建這套軍火庫,強烈建議閱讀以下幾篇深度教學:

想為你的企業導入 AI 自動化開發流程?或是需要量身打造的高效能 WordPress 架構?

立即聯繫浪花科技,讓我們協助你實現數位轉型

常見問題 (FAQ)

Q1: Vibe Coding 寫出來的程式碼安全嗎?

這是一個很好的問題。AI 生成的程式碼雖然效率高,但確實可能包含漏洞(例如忘記權限驗證或輸入過濾)。這就是為什麼即使有了 Vibe Stack,你(或你的技術顧問)仍需具備 Code Review 的能力。在上述 WordPress 範例中,我特別加入了 permission_callback 就是為了確保安全性。永遠不要直接盲目使用 AI 生成的 Code。

Q2: 使用 WordPress 當作 App 後端會不會效能太差?

不會,前提是你要會用。如果你只是安裝一堆臃腫的外掛,當然會慢。但如果你像我們一樣,將 WordPress 視為框架,手寫高效的 API 端點,並配合 Redis 快取與正確的資料庫索引,WordPress 的效能足以支撐數百萬級別的流量。Indie Hacker 初期更應該關注開發速度,而非過度優化。

Q3: n8n 和 Zapier 有什麼不同?為什麼推薦 n8n?

Zapier 很棒,但對於開發者來說太貴且限制多。n8n 可以自架(Self-hosted),這意味著你可以擁有無限的 Workflow 執行次數而不需支付高額月費。此外,n8n 的節點設計更接近程式邏輯(有 Loop、If-Else、Merge),更適合處理複雜的業務邏輯。

 
立即諮詢,索取免費1年網站保固